Comp Sec Posted April 5, 2018 Author Share Posted April 5, 2018 There is a mix of drivers and trailers. the venue is not a permanent motorsport venue, as it's in the middle of the MOD training area. imagine a closed road event in the middle of a hilly moorland miles from civilisation and your not far wrong. but I will say its a bit Marmite, either you really like it's quickyness or its not your cup of tea. Personnally I do really and enjoy it.and yes the entries close on the day of the event...... The do get a couple of there locals who turn up on the day with the licence application form, licence payment and the event fee...I normal camp on venue but if you have a look for B&B's around Trecastle there are quite a few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Comp Sec Posted June 13, 2018 Author Share Posted June 13, 2018 The times are in the regs.6. Time Schedule for both events.The event format will be as follows:Sign-on Marshals 08:30 – 09:30Drivers 08:30 – 09:30Scrutineering 08:30 – 10:00Drivers briefing 09:45Convoy drive of course 10:00First Practice 10:30First timed run 13:30Any driver not signed on by 09:30 may be excluded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
